How Cash-Out Refinancing Works

A cash-out refinance replaces your existing mortgage with a new loan that’s larger than your current balance, giving you the difference in cash.

Example:
If your Maine home is worth $400,000 and you owe $250,000, you could refinance and take a portion of that equity as cash.

What is a cash-out refinance in Maine?

It’s a mortgage that replaces your current loan with a larger one, allowing you to take cash from your home equity.

How much equity can I access?

Most lenders allow up to 80% of your home’s value, depending on credit, loan type, and property.

Is a cash-out refinance better than a HELOC?

It depends. A cash-out refinance provides a fixed rate and single monthly payment, while a HELOC is flexible but variable. I can help you compare both options.

Will my monthly payment increase?

It may, but I structure loans to fit your financial plan—sometimes consolidating debt offsets the increase.

What credit score do I need?

Most programs start around 620, but higher scores improve terms and options.

How long does it take in Maine?

Most loans close in 2–4 weeks depending on documentation and loan complexity.
